In a proactive move to harness the power of artificial intelligence, Naval Facilities Engineering Systems Command Europe Africa Central leadership conducted a command-wide AI training stand-down Sept. 19 and 26, 2025.
The training reflects key priorities outlined in "Winning the Race: America's AI Action Plan", a strategic national approach to maintain U.S. leadership in AI through increased investment in research, development of AI-ready workforce, and promotion of trustworthy AI systems, while informing employees with the knowledge to leverage the technology for enhanced operational efficiency and mission accomplishment.

At Naval Facilities Engineering Systems Command (NAVFAC) Europe, Africa, Central (EURAFCENT), infrastructure is as vital to naval power as ships, aircraft, and personnel. From maintaining installations and airfields to managing utilities, roads, offices, and housing, the Public Works Department (PWD) at Naval Support Activity (NSA) Souda Bay ensures operational forces have safe, functional, and effective facilities.
